Apple Configurator 2 performance

I've used Apple Configurator for years for side loading IPA files from development builds. In Apple Configurator 2, once I drag the IPA over to the device, it sits for a long to "Waiting for the device". Anyone know why this is and if there's a way to speed this up? I never had this delay in v1.

What seemed to work for me was that when the iPad is connected and AC2 is stuck in "Waiting for the device" (and there is a spinning wheel on the iPad in the upper left of the screen): I tried holding the sleep/wake button and the home button for about 10 seconds until the device hard resets. When it comes awake and I unlock the device, Apple Configurator 2 seems to force start whatever process was waiting for the device. This has worked twice for me, however, a hard restart is required for each AC2 action, unfortunately. I think a better long term fix is to restore the device and restart the computer.
